public class ResourceBusinessConfigurationType extends Object implements Serializable, Cloneable, Containerable
Java class for ResourceBusinessConfigurationType complex type.
The following schema fragment specifies the expected content contained within this class.
<complexType name="ResourceBusinessConfigurationType"> <complexContent> <restriction base="{http://www.w3.org/2001/XMLSchema}anyType"> <sequence> <element name="administrativeState" type="{http://midpoint.evolveum.com/xml/ns/public/common/common-3}ResourceAdministrativeStateType" minOccurs="0"/> <element name="approverRef" type="{http://midpoint.evolveum.com/xml/ns/public/common/common-3}ObjectReferenceType" maxOccurs="unbounded" minOccurs="0"/> <element name="ownerRef" type="{http://midpoint.evolveum.com/xml/ns/public/common/common-3}ObjectReferenceType" maxOccurs="unbounded" minOccurs="0"/> <element name="operatorRef" type="{http://midpoint.evolveum.com/xml/ns/public/common/common-3}ObjectReferenceType" maxOccurs="unbounded" minOccurs="0"/> </sequence> <attribute name="id" type="{http://www.w3.org/2001/XMLSchema}long" /> </restriction> </complexContent> </complexType>
Modifier and Type | Field and Description |
---|---|
static QName |
COMPLEX_TYPE |
static QName |
F_ADMINISTRATIVE_STATE |
static QName |
F_APPROVER_REF |
static QName |
F_OPERATOR_REF |
static QName |
F_OWNER_REF |
Constructor and Description |
---|
ResourceBusinessConfigurationType() |
ResourceBusinessConfigurationType(PrismContext prismContext) |
public static final QName COMPLEX_TYPE
public static final QName F_ADMINISTRATIVE_STATE
public static final QName F_APPROVER_REF
public static final QName F_OWNER_REF
public static final QName F_OPERATOR_REF
public ResourceBusinessConfigurationType()
public ResourceBusinessConfigurationType(PrismContext prismContext)
public PrismContainerValue asPrismContainerValue()
asPrismContainerValue
in interface Containerable
public void setupContainerValue(PrismContainerValue containerValue)
Containerable
setupContainerValue
in interface Containerable
public <X> X end()
public ResourceAdministrativeStateType getAdministrativeState()
public void setAdministrativeState(ResourceAdministrativeStateType value)
public List<ObjectReferenceType> getApproverRef()
public List<ObjectReferenceType> createApproverRefList()
public List<ObjectReferenceType> getOwnerRef()
public List<ObjectReferenceType> createOwnerRefList()
public List<ObjectReferenceType> getOperatorRef()
public List<ObjectReferenceType> createOperatorRefList()
public Long getId()
public void setId(Long value)
public ResourceBusinessConfigurationType administrativeState(ResourceAdministrativeStateType value)
public ResourceBusinessConfigurationType approverRef(ObjectReferenceType value)
public ResourceBusinessConfigurationType approverRef(String oid, QName type)
public ResourceBusinessConfigurationType approverRef(String oid, QName type, QName relation)
public ObjectReferenceType beginApproverRef()
public ResourceBusinessConfigurationType ownerRef(ObjectReferenceType value)
public ResourceBusinessConfigurationType ownerRef(String oid, QName type)
public ResourceBusinessConfigurationType ownerRef(String oid, QName type, QName relation)
public ObjectReferenceType beginOwnerRef()
public ResourceBusinessConfigurationType operatorRef(ObjectReferenceType value)
public ResourceBusinessConfigurationType operatorRef(String oid, QName type)
public ResourceBusinessConfigurationType operatorRef(String oid, QName type, QName relation)
public ObjectReferenceType beginOperatorRef()
public ResourceBusinessConfigurationType id(Long value)
public ResourceBusinessConfigurationType clone()
Copyright © 2019 Evolveum. All rights reserved.